- Original: χαλιναγωγέω
- Transliteration: Chalinagogeo
- Phonetic: khal-in-ag-ogue-eh'-o
- Definition:
1. to lead by a bridle, to guide
2. to bridle, hold in check, restrain
- Origin: from a compound of
G5469 and the reduplicated form of
G71
- TDNT entry: None
- Part(s) of speech: Verb
- Strong's: From a compound of
G5469 and the reduplicated form of
G71 ; to be a bit leader that is to curb (figuratively): - bridle.
